See http://blogs.atlassian.com/rebelutionary/archives/000176.html For unit testing, screw Cactus! (sorry Vincent - it is really cool, but too slow for any unit testing) Cactus is meant for acceptance testing. public void testMyAction() { MyAction action = new MyAction(); action.setId(10); String result = action.execute(); assertEquals(Action.SUCCESS, result); } That will run VERY fast :) Occasionally you need to execute an action through WW's framework (ie to test validations or IoC) but even that's not too difficult - just a line or two more using ActionProxy's.
